    Features to Consider When Choosing a DEWALT Drill

    When selecting a DEWALT drill for your woodworking and masonry projects, there are key features you should keep in mind to ensure you get the best tool for the job.

    Power and Speed

    Consideration: The power and speed of the drill greatly impact its performance on different materials.

    Tip: Look for drills with high torque and variable speed settings to handle both wood and masonry effectively.

    Chuck Size

    Consideration: The chuck size determines the range of drill bits the tool can accommodate.

    Tip: Opt for a DEWALT drill with a versatile chuck size (e.g., 1/2 inch) to use various drill bits for different project requirements.

    Battery Life and Type

    Consideration: Cordless drills rely on battery power, making battery life and type crucial factors.

    Tip: Choose a DEWALT drill with long battery life and lithium-ion batteries for extended use without frequent recharging.

    Ergonomics and Comfort

    Consideration: Comfort is essential for prolonged use without fatigue.

    Tip: Select a drill with a comfortable grip and ergonomic design that reduces strain on your hands and body during operation.

    Durability and Build Quality

    Consideration: The durability of the drill impacts its longevity and performance under tough conditions.

    Tip: Opt for DEWALT drills known for their robust build quality, ensuring they can withstand the demands of woodworking and masonry tasks.

    Versatility and Functionality

    Consideration: A versatile drill offers functionality beyond basic drilling tasks.

    Tip: Choose a DEWALT drill with features like hammer action for masonry work and adjustable clutch settings for precision in woodwork.

    Accessories and Attachments

    Consideration: Additional accessories and attachments enhance the drill’s capabilities for diverse projects.

    Tip: Consider DEWALT drills that come with a range of accessories such as drill bits, battery packs, and carrying cases to maximize utility.

    By considering these features when choosing a DEWALT drill, you can select the right tool that meets your specific woodworking and masonry needs effectively.

    Top DEWALT Drills for Wood and Masonry

    When choosing a DeWalt drill for your woodworking and masonry projects, it’s essential to select the right tool that meets your specific requirements. Here are some of the top DeWalt drills that excel in handling both wood and masonry tasks effectively:

    DEWALT DCD791D2 20V MAX XR Li-Ion Brushless Compact Drill/Driver Kit

    The DEWALT DCD791D2 is a powerful and compact drill/driver kit suitable for various applications, including woodworking and masonry. With its brushless motor, this drill offers long runtime and exceptional performance. The two-speed transmission provides versatility for different tasks, while the ergonomic design ensures comfortable use, reducing fatigue during long hours of work.

    DEWALT DCD996B 20V MAX XR Hammer Drill

    For more demanding masonry tasks, the DEWALT DCD996B hammer drill is a reliable choice. It features a high-performance transmission for increased speed and improved run time. The brushless motor delivers up to 75% more runtime than standard brushed motors. The three-speed settings allow you to customize the tool’s performance based on the task at hand, making it ideal for both wood and masonry projects.

    See Also:  Choosing the Best Drill for Lag Screws: Key Features & Tips

    DEWALT DCK299D1T1 Flexvolt Brushless Hammerdrill and Impact Driver Combo Kit

    If you’re looking for a versatile solution for your woodworking and masonry projects, the DEWALT DCK299D1T1 combo kit is a great option. This kit includes a brushless hammer drill and an impact driver, providing you with the tools needed to tackle a wide range of tasks. The Flexvolt technology offers increased power and runtime, ensuring that you can handle even the most challenging projects with ease.

    Tips for Using DEWALT Drills for Wood and Masonry

    When using DEWALT drills for your wood and masonry projects, here are some tips to help you maximize their effectiveness and get the best results:

    1. Select the Right Drill Bit

    Make sure you use the appropriate drill bit for the material you are working with. For wood, choose a sharp twist bit, while for masonry, opt for a masonry bit. Using the correct bit ensures cleaner and more precise drilling.

    2. Adjust Speed Settings

    Depending on the material you are drilling through, adjust the speed settings on your DEWALT drill. Lower speeds work well for wood to prevent splintering, while higher speeds are suitable for masonry to increase drilling efficiency.

    3. Maintain Proper Pressure

    Apply consistent but not excessive pressure when drilling to avoid damaging the material or the drill bit. Let the drill do the work, especially when working with harder surfaces like masonry.

    4. Use Support for Masonry Drilling

    When drilling into masonry surfaces, place a piece of scrap wood behind the drilling spot to prevent damage to the surface underneath and to provide additional support for a cleaner hole.

    5. Regularly Check Battery Life

    Ensure your DEWALT drill’s battery is fully charged before starting any project to prevent interruptions. Regularly check the battery life during longer tasks and have a spare battery on hand if needed.

    6. Secure Your Workpiece

    For precise and safe drilling, secure your wood or masonry workpiece using clamps or a vice. This helps prevent shifting or slipping during drilling, ensuring accuracy.

    7. Clean and Maintain Your Drill

    After each use, clean your DEWALT drill to remove dust and debris that can affect its performance. Regularly inspect for any signs of wear or damage, and lubricate moving parts as recommended by the manufacturer.

    By following these practical tips, you can make the most of your DEWALT drill for both wood and masonry projects, ensuring efficient and accurate results every time.
